MU18 vs MU30 vs SR55 vs SR80: How Procurement Teams Should Compare Quotes

Many industrial buyers still compare ultrasonic sensor quotes the same way they compare commodity hardware: they collect a few model numbers, line up unit prices, and treat the lowest visible number as the commercial benchmark. That method looks efficient, but it usually fails when the quote set includes different sensor classes. A compact short-range MU18 short-range option, a general-purpose MU30 general-purpose model, an SR55 waterproof level class, and an SR80 long-range sensor are not interchangeable commercial lines with different sticker prices. They belong to different application envelopes, which means the quotes cannot be compared responsibly until procurement normalizes the requirement.
That is the hidden problem when teams ask for "price" too early. Buyers are often not asking for a public list price. They are asking which quote should be treated as the correct baseline, which assumptions are missing from the cheaper offer, and why two suppliers can both sound reasonable while recommending different models. If those questions stay unresolved, the lowest quote often wins for the wrong reason: it simply assumed less.
